WHAT IS IT?
Microblading is a form of tattooing. Unlike a regular tattoo, microblading uses a manual handheld tool instead of a machine. Pigment is implanted under your skin, by drawing hair-like strokes with the tool to mimic natural hairs in your brows. The pigment is not implanted as deep as a regular tattoo.
PREPARE
Avoid Retinol, blood thinners, aspirin, and alcohol for one week prior to treatment. Retinol makes your skin thin and can cause you to bleed a little more.
DOES IT HURT?
We'll prep your brows with topical numbing cream prior to your treatment. Typically, it feels like little scratches. Some feel it more than others.
TIME
Your initial treatment will take about 2 hours.
AFTERCARE
Protect your freshly bladed brows from all moisture - no sweaty workouts or washing your face with water until your healing is complete. After healing, you can rub them and enjoy swimming. You might experience itching and redness during the first week. Vaseline can relieve these symptoms. Your brows might look slightly darker at first, but the color will fade 30 to 40 percent.
RESULTS
We typically have you return for touch-ups every six months.
